ATLANTA -- The Falcons are preparing for a trip to Arizona for the Wild Card round of the playoffs but opponents for the 2009 regular season were determined after the first round of games on Sunday afternoon.
Atlanta will play the NFC and AFC East next season and take on the No. 2 team in the NFC West and North -- teams that match its finish in the NFC South.
The Falcons will travel to Tampa Bay, Carolina, New Orleans, Dallas and New England next season. The team will also go to New York twice to face the Jets and Giants. The San Francisco 49ers locked up the No. 2 spot in the NFC West last week and will host the Falcons at some point next season (NFC West). The Birds will host division opponents, Washington, Philadelphia, Buffalo and Miami and Chicago (NFC North).
The dates and times for the 2009 regular season will be announced in the Spring. Click here for an explanation of schedule rotations.
